数据库

数据库存储过程详解

/*存储过程可以看作是在数据库中的存储t-sql脚本为什么使用存储过程1、增加性能 本地存储发送的内容少、调用快、预编译、高速缓存 一般语句的执行:检查权限、检查语法,建立执行计划处理语句的要求 存储过程:创建时

oracle中存储过程的out参数是什么

在oracle中,存储过程中的out参数是输出模式的参数,用于输出值,会忽略传入的值,在子程序内部可以对其进行修改,子程序执行完毕后,out模式参数最终的值会赋值给调用时对应的实参变量,其中out模式参数的调用,必须通过变量。本教程操作环境

mysql出现系统错误1058怎么办

mysql出现系统错误1058的原因是已经被禁用或与其相关联的设备没有启动;解决方法:1、在计算机管理服务中设置mysql服务属性中的启动类型为自动;2、修改“%SystemRoot%my.ini”文件的相关内容即可。本教程操作环境:win

带你吃透Redis中的主从复制、Sentinel、集群

本篇文章给大家介绍一下Redis分布式的相关知识,带大家吃透主从复制、Sentinel、集群,让你的Redis水平更上一层!一、主从复制1、简介主从复制是Redis分布式的基石,也是Redis高可用的保障。在Redis中,被复制的服务器称为

数据库备份的两种方法是什么

数据库备份的两种方法是:1、使用mysqldump结合exec函数进行数据库备份;2、使用【php+mysql+header】函数进行数据库备份。数据库备份是必要的一般都是使用mysqldump进行备份,我这边写了两种备份方法可以参考一下。

mysql与pl/sql有什么区别

mysql与“pl/sql”的区别:1、mysql是一个关系型数据库管理系统,“pl/sql”是一种过程化SQL程序语言;2、“pl/sql”利用web的多媒体特性将各种数据类型集合成数据包,mysql而是将非传统数据存储到单独的服务器里。

怎么查询oracle归档日志

在oracle中,可以利用select语句配合“v$recovery_file_dest”查询oracle归档日志,select语句用于从数据库中选取数据,语法为“select * from v$recovery_file_dest”。本教

怎么解决启动mysql的1069错误

启动mysql的1069错误出现的原因是更改了服务器的登录密码,解决方法:1、在管理用户中找到mysql用户并重新设置mysql密码;2、在服务中找到mysql服务选项,在属性中通过更改后的密码重新登录mysql服务即可。本教程操作环境:w

oracle怎么给表增加分区

在oracle中,可以利用ALTER语句配合“ADD PARTITION”给表添加分区,语法为“ALTER TABLE 表名 ADD PARTITION 分区 VALUES”。本教程操作环境:Windows10系统、Oracle 11g版、

数据库的事务隔离级别有哪些?

在数据库操作中,为了有效保证并发读取数据的正确性,提出的事务隔离级别。在标准SQL规范中,定义了4个事务隔离级别,不同的隔离级别对事务的处理不同。下面本篇文章就来给大家介绍一下事务隔离级别,希望对你们有所帮助。一般的数据库,包括四种隔离级别

常用sql语句有哪些

常用的sql语句1.数据库相关查所有数据库 show databases创建数据库 create database db1查看数据库 show create database db1创建数据库指定字符集 create database db

oracle怎么多行转一行

在oracle中,可以利用listagg函数配合“order by”子句实现多行转一行,该语句可以对数据进行排序,然后将排序的结果拼接起来,语法为“listagg (列名,‘分隔符’) within group(order by 列名)”。

json是什么

json是什么?JSON(JavaScript Object Notation) 是一种轻量级的数据交换格式,易于阅读和编写,同时也易于机器解析和生成。。JSON的结构基于下面两点1. "名称/值"对的集合不同语言中,它被理解为对象(obj

怎么修改mysql服务路径

修改方法:1、利用regedit找到mysql注册表,修改ImagePath值的路径即可修改mysql可执行文件路径;2、修改“my.ini”文件中datadir的值后重新启动mysql服务,即可修改mysql数据库的文件路径。本教程操作环

oracle怎么修改时区

oracle修改时区的方法:1、利用“alter database set time_zone=+8:00;”语句修改时区;2、利用“shutdown immediate”和“startup”命令重新启动数据库即可。本教程操作环境:Wind

sql执行顺序是什么

SQL语句的执行顺序MySQL的语句一共分为11步,如下图所标注的那样,最先执行的总是FROM操作,最后执行的是LIMIT操作。其中每一个操作都会产生一张虚拟的表,这个虚拟的表作为一个处理的输入,只是这些虚拟的表对用户来说是透明的,但是只有

oracle怎么增加字段长度

在oracle中,可以利用alter语句配合modify来增加字段长度,modify用于修改字段类型和长度,即修改字段的属性,语法为“alter table 表名 modify(字段名 字段类型)”。本教程操作环境:Windows10系统、

常用的关系型数据库有哪些?

关系数据库,是建立在关系模型基础上的数据库,借助于集合代数等数学概念和方法来处理数据库中的数据。现实世界中的各种实体以及实体之间的各种联系均用关系模型来表示。标准数据查询语言SQL就是一种基于关系数据库的语言,这种语言执行对关系数据库中数据

mysql怎么查询空值

在mysql中,可以利用SELECT语句配合IS NULL关键字来查询空值,IS NULL关键字用于判断字段的值是否为空值,若字段的值是空值,则显示在结果中,语法为“SELECT * FROM 表名 WHERE 字段名 IS NULL;”。

sql优化的几种方法

1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引。2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描,如:select id